If Providence Day was feeling good fresh off their 3-0 takedown of Charlotte Christian last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Providence Day Chargers fell 3-1 to the Charlotte Latin Hawks on Wednesday. The Chargers were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Hawks ap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in September.

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-14, 25-21, 26-28, 25-12.

Alison Archibald was a one-man wrecking crew for Charlotte Latin as she had 16 digs. Archibald is on a roll when it comes to digs, as she's now had 11 or more in the last 19 games she's played dating back to last season.

Providence Day's loss was their fourth stra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 10-11. As for Charlotte Latin, their victory bumped their record up to 17-5.

As of now, neither Providence Day nor Charlotte Latin have any future games scheduled.
